I see it's having "old GM headliner" issues.

#2
7-17-2010 @ 05:11:18 PM
Posted By : Low-Tech Redneck Reply | Edit | Del
#1, Whatever that glue/adhesive is, it just DOES NOT last more than 10 years, even in the best circumstances, the only reason the Grand Prix isn't doing it is because the trim for the T-tops and a pair of coat hangers on the inside of the pillars are keeping it up, otherwise, it'd be in my lap

#3
7-17-2010 @ 05:18:00 PM
Posted By : Skid Reply | Edit | Del
Luckily, the headliners aren't terribly expensive to replace (a new one for my Camaro was only about $60 or so at a local upholstery shop), but it seems like most people just don't want to bother.

#4
7-17-2010 @ 05:49:22 PM
Posted By : wannabemustangjockey  Reply | Edit | Del
The headliner dropped on my 6K a decade ago. We got that sucker replaced after it started billowing in the wind with the windows down.
